Public & Private Companies Commencement of Business –Immediately –After Approval by SECP Allotment of Shares –The allotment of shares is the issuing of new shares to the existing shareholders or to third parties. The Directors of a Company may allotshares in the capital of the Company, if they have the authority to do so.

Public & Private Companies Statutory Meeting –No Need for Private Co –Legal Binding for Public Co Issuance of Prospectus –A document containing detailed information about the company and an invitation to the public subscribing to the share capital and debentures is issued.

Public & Private Companies Framing Articles –All limited companies must have articles of association. These set the rules company officers must follow when running their companies. –When a company limited by shares was incorporated, it didn’t need to file articles if it used ‘Table A’ as its articles.

Public & Private Companies Transfer of Shares –Transfer of shares is a transfer of ownership of shares - such as a purchase/ sale or gift. The shares were owned by one person before the transfer and a different person after the transfer. Registration of shares is generally a process in which Company’s authority grants some designation to certain shares
